Understanding the Mechanics of Sky Signin

At its core, sky signin operates through a sophisticated interplay of encryption, tokenization, and real-time data analysis. When a user initiates a session, the system does not merely check a username and password; it evaluates the digital fingerprint of the request. This fingerprint includes the device signature, geographic location derived from the IP address, and the specific network characteristics. The authentication engine cross-references this data against historical patterns to determine if the signin attempt aligns with the established user profile, effectively distinguishing between the account holder and a potential intruder.

The Role of Environmental Context

One of the most advanced features of modern sky signin is its reliance on environmental context. Rather than treating a login from a new country as a standard event, the system assesses the risk based on velocity and proximity. For instance, if a login occurs in London immediately followed by a login attempt in New York within an hour, the system flags this as impossible travel and triggers additional verification steps. This intelligent analysis ensures that security measures adapt dynamically to the perceived threat level, protecting sensitive data without unnecessarily burdening the legitimate user.

Biometric and Behavioral Integration

To further enhance security, sky signin integrations have begun to incorporate biometric and behavioral analytics. Users may be required to authenticate using facial recognition, fingerprint scanning, or voice identification, adding a physical layer of security that is impossible to replicate remotely. Behavioral analysis takes this a step further by monitoring typing rhythm, mouse movements, and navigation patterns. These subtle nuances create a continuous authentication loop, ensuring that the person who initially signed in is still the person interacting with the platform moments later.

Compliance and Regulatory Alignment

For businesses operating in regulated industries, sky signin is not just a security feature but a compliance necessity. Frameworks such as GDPR, HIPAA, and CCPA mandate strict controls over user identity and data access. Implementing advanced signin protocols helps organizations meet these legal requirements by providing an auditable trail of authentication events. The ability to demonstrate that proper identity verification measures were in place is crucial during audits and helps prevent costly penalties associated with data breaches.
